Chinese automaker Chery Auto is starting sales in Italy, with an ICE version of its Omoda 5 crossover SUV, Reuters reports.

The move comes as it weighs up its options to expand its manufacturing capacity and sales in Europe.

The ICE version of the Omoda 5 will be priced from €27,900 ($30,182).

Chery is one of the Chinese automakers impacted by the EU’s recent decision to confirm tariffs on EV imports made in China, with Chery subject to an additional duty of 20.8%.

By the end of 2025, the automaker plans three SUV models each for its Omoda and Jaecoo brands, but will use a mixture of fuel types for different European markets, according to Reuters.
